原标题:java如何连接sqlserver数据库

java如何连接sqlserver数据库

首先下载JDBC:

下载 完成后,是个exe文件,点击运行,会提示你选择解压目录.

解压完成后,进入 \sqljdbc_3.0\chs,里边有两个我们需要的东东

一个是:sqljdbc.jar,另外一个是sqljdbc4.jar

这里使用sqljdbc4.jar

首先配置sa身份验证:

java中使用jdbc连接sql server数据库步骤:

1.JDBC连接SQL Server的驱动安装 ,前两个是属于数据库软件,正常安装即可(注意数据库登陆不要使用windows验证)

<1> 将JDBC解压缩到任意位置,比如解压到C盘program files下面,并在安装目录里找到sqljdbc.jar文件,得到其路径开始配置环境变量

在环境变量classpath 后面追加 C:\Program Files\Microsoft SQL Server2005 JDBC Driver\sqljdbc_1.2\enu\sqljdbc.jar

<2> 设置SQLEXPRESS服务器:

a.打开SQL Server Configuration Manager -> SQLEXPRESS的协议 -> TCP/IP

b.右键单击启动TCP/IP

c.双击进入属性,把IP地址中的IP all中的TCP端口设置为1433

d.重新启动SQL Server 2005服务中的SQLEXPRESS服务器

e.关闭SQL Server Configuration Manager

<3> 打开 SQL Server Management Studio,连接SQLEXPRESS服务器, 新建数据库,起名字为sample

<4> 打开Eclipse

a.新建工程-> Java -> Java project,起名为Test

b.选择eclipse->窗口->首选项->Java->installed JRE 编辑已经安装好的jdk,查找目录添加sqljdbc.jar

c.右键单击目录窗口中的Test, 选择Build Path ->Configure Build Path..., 添加扩展jar文件,即把sqljdbc.jar添加到其中

<5> 编写Java代码来测试JDBC连接SQL Server数据库

import java.sql.*;

public class Test {

public static void main(String[] srg) {

//加载JDBC驱动

String driverName = "com.microsoft.sqlserver.jdbc.SQLServerDriver";

//连接服务器和数据库sample

String dbURL = "jdbc:sqlserver://localhost:1433; DatabaseName=sample";

String userName = "sa"; //默认用户名

String userPwd = "123456"; //密码

Connection dbConn;

try {

Class.forName(driverName);

dbConn = DriverManager.getConnection(dbURL, userName, userPwd);

System.out.println("Connection Successful!"); //如果连接成功 控制台输出

} catch (Exception e) {

e.printStackTrace();

}

}

}

执行以后就可以连接到sqlserver数据库了。

责任编辑:

java 连接sqlserver_java如何连接sqlserver数据库相关推荐

  1. python连接并简单操作SQLserver数据库

    python连接并简单操作SQLserver数据库 实验环境: python版本3.9 Python 3.9.7 (tags/v3.9.7:1016ef3, Aug 30 2021, 20:19:38 ...

  2. JDBC连接oracle,mysql,sqlserver数据库

    JDBC的全称是:Java Database Connectivity,即Java数据库连接. JDBC可以通过载入不同的数据库的"驱动程序"而与不同的数据库进行连接.所以JDBC ...

  3. 无法连接局域网中的sqlserver数据库

    在SQL Server配置工具---SQL Server配置管理器中,配置tcp/ip商品为1344(?未验证是否一定要) 以下详细见:http://blog.csdn.net/zongzhankui ...

  4. sqlserver远程连接mysql_sqlserver远程连接

    通过配置Windows 防火墙允许使用TCP/IP协议远程访问数据库 原文: 通过配置Windows 防火墙允许使用TCP/IP协议远程访问数据库 本文适用于:2005.2008.2008R2所有版本 ...

  5. Python读取excel文件内容并保存到SqlServer数据库

      前面两篇文章<python调用openpyxl包操作excel文件>和<python调用pymssql包操作SqlServer数据库>学习了Python操作excel和Sq ...

  6. Java通过JDBC来连接SqlServer数据库

    Java通过JDBC来连接SqlServer数据库 0.       安装配置Java运行的环境,就不废话了 1.       下载JDBC的驱动程序http://msdn.microsoft.com ...

  7. Java连接sqlserver数据库,并进行增删改查操作

    用编程语言连接数据库是程序员必备的技能,今天我们就来学习一下如何通过Java来连接sqlserver数据库,并实现增删改查操作. 需要用到的工具: Myeclipse,sqlserver数据库,Mic ...

  8. 从零开始的java连接sqlserver数据库教程

    通过java连接sqlserver数据库教程 使用的数据库是SQL Server 2008,实现利用java对数据库进行操作. 需要做的准备: SQL Server 2008.JDBC驱动包(sqlj ...

  9. java sqlserver数据库_java连接sqlserver2008数据库配置

    1.首先要去Microsoft官网下载sqljdbc2.0驱动--Microsoft SQL Server JDBC Driver 2.0.exe,很小大概就4M,解压后里面有2个Jar包,sqljd ...

最新文章

  1. 基于人脸识别、姿态检测、距离估计的看电视姿态检测
  2. ElementUI中使用el-time-picker向SpringBoot传输24小时制时间参数以及数据库中怎样存储
  3. SpringMVC框架结构以及架构流程
  4. 计算机组成原理 第四章【指令系统】课后作业解析【MOOC答案】
  5. 别翻了,成员变量和局部变量在多线程中的使用,看这篇就够了
  6. vim 中的 quickfix 指令
  7. 实例38:python
  8. oracle 建表id自增长_oracle 左连接、右连接、全外连接、内连接、以及 (+) 号用法...
  9. ltsc系统激活_WIN10_X64企业版LTSC 电脑公司装机版 202008
  10. scanf( )函数的返回值
  11. CVPR2019 | AlphaPose升级!上交大开源密集人群姿态估计代码
  12. IE overflow:hidden失效的解决方法:
  13. linux 写一个包含test的脚本程序,linux的test命令及相关shell脚本详解
  14. andoid-sdk 安装时出现 Stopping ADB server failed(code -1) 错
  15. 计算机学术会议英语作文,计算机专业资料——重要国际学术会议
  16. [转载].程序匠人 - 程序调试(除错)过程中的一些雕虫小技
  17. java基础之静态代理和动态代理
  18. python利用PIL及openpyxl实现图片转为excel表格
  19. H5抽奖十二宫格声音问题
  20. 计算机主板知识,电脑主板知识:主板板型、接口、做工与选购详解

热门文章

  1. JDBC与ORM发展与联系 JDBC简介(九)
  2. 再一次获取你的WIFI密码(fluxion附视频)
  3. IT行业里的热门技术和项目分享
  4. 神策数据王乾:微信生态与小程序发展趋势洞察
  5. QTableView和QTableWidget的区别是什么?
  6. 【元宇宙欧米说】从GameFi的视角讨论Web2到Web3的利弊
  7. LTE学习-信道估计(LS算法)
  8. 判断密码是否由数字,大小写字母和特殊符号组成(排除中文)
  9. Cmd命令行实验4-ARP
  10. 菜鸟的springboot项目图片上传及图片路径分析